Grades on the FAU/MTSU Game
We had more yards, more first downs, and ran thirty more plays…
here is the dealio from Ted Hutton…i have to agree with him:
"Don?t pin this on the defense. The only legitimate score they gave up was the first one, on an 85-yard drive. The next TD came after Rusty Smith?s fumble gave the Raiders the ball at the FAU 28. The next was the kickoff return for TD, the next the fumble return, and the final one in the last minute, on Eugene Gross 56-yard run on a play that shouldn?t have happened."
